Abstract
Variation exists regarding understandings of the personality trait introversion. This thesis aimed to explore how ordinary people define and experience introversion. Three studies were conducted which explored: 1) participants’ understandings of introversion; 2) differences in how people who identified as introverted, ambiverted (a bit of both), or extraverted described introverts; and 3) self-identified introverts’ descriptions of a broad range of experiences in their own lives. The findings of this research indicated that further efforts are needed to develop additional clarity and agreement across both scientific and common-sense views as to what introversion represents.
